1. Tesla Model 3
The Tesla Model 3 remains one of the most popular EVs on the market.
- Key Features: Up to 358 miles of range, minimalistic interior, and Tesla’s Autopilot system.
- Why It’s the Best: Combining affordability, performance, and cutting-edge technology, it’s an all-around winner.
- Target Audience: Perfect for tech-savvy drivers and eco-conscious families.
2. Ford Mustang Mach-E
Ford’s all-electric Mustang Mach-E combines performance with style.
- Key Features: Up to 312 miles of range, impressive acceleration, and a luxurious cabin.
- Why It Stands Out: It merges the spirit of a classic muscle car with sustainable energy.
- Target Audience: Great for those who want a blend of tradition and innovation.
3. Hyundai Ioniq 6
Hyundai’s Ioniq 6 is a sleek sedan offering futuristic design and practicality.
- Key Features: Up to 360 miles of range, ultra-fast charging, and a tech-filled interior.
- Why It’s a Contender: Combines aesthetics with functionality, making it ideal for city and highway driving.
- Target Audience: Ideal for urban professionals.
4. Rivian R1T
Rivian’s R1T is a game-changer in the electric pickup market.
- Key Features: Up to 400 miles of range, rugged design, and off-road capabilities.
- Why It Excels: Perfect for adventurers who need a robust yet sustainable vehicle.
- Target Audience: Outdoor enthusiasts and heavy-duty users.
5. Lucid Air
The Lucid Air is redefining luxury in the EV world.
- Key Features: Up to 516 miles of range, an opulent interior, and cutting-edge driver assistance.
- Why It’s Unique: Combines unparalleled range with an ultra-premium experience.
- Target Audience: Luxury seekers and executives.
6. Nissan Ariya
Nissan’s Ariya is an all-electric crossover designed for everyday convenience.
- Key Features: Up to 300 miles of range, spacious interior, and user-friendly tech.
- Why It’s Reliable: Affordable without compromising quality.
- Target Audience: Families looking for an eco-friendly SUV.
7. BMW iX
BMW’s flagship EV, the iX, delivers an upscale driving experience.
- Key Features: Up to 324 miles of range, advanced safety features, and seamless connectivity.
- Why It’s Desirable: Combines BMW’s signature performance with sustainability.
- Target Audience: Those who prioritize performance and brand prestige.
8. Chevrolet Bolt EUV
Chevrolet’s Bolt EUV offers affordability and practicality in one package.
- Key Features: Up to 247 miles of range, compact design, and budget-friendly pricing.
- Why It’s Worth Considering: Great for urban dwellers on a budget.
- Target Audience: Cost-conscious buyers.
9. Porsche Taycan
Porsche’s Taycan is the pinnacle of performance EVs.
- Key Features: Up to 282 miles of range, lightning-fast acceleration, and a luxurious interior.
- Why It’s Coveted: Perfect for thrill-seekers who refuse to compromise on luxury.
- Target Audience: Driving enthusiasts.
10. Kia EV9
Kia’s EV9 redefines what an electric SUV can be.
- Key Features: Up to 300 miles of range, three-row seating, and innovative features.
- Why It’s Family-Friendly: Designed for larger families and group travel.
- Target Audience: Families needing space without sacrificing sustainability.
10 Tips for Choosing the Best Electric Vehicle
- Determine Your Needs: Consider your daily driving range, family size, and storage needs.
- Evaluate Charging Options: Assess availability of home, public, and fast-charging stations.
- Check Incentives: Research government tax credits and rebates for EV buyers.
- Consider Maintenance Costs: EVs are cheaper to maintain, but check for warranty and service options.
- Focus on Range: Choose a range that covers your daily travel plus a buffer.
- Test Drive: Experience the performance and features firsthand.
- Assess Connectivity: Look for user-friendly infotainment systems and smart features.
- Budget Wisely: Factor in the total cost of ownership, not just the sticker price.
- Investigate Safety Features: Ensure advanced safety tech is included.
- Think About Resale Value: Opt for brands with strong market reputation.
FAQs About Electric Vehicles
- Are EVs more expensive than gas cars? While upfront costs can be higher, EVs save money on fuel and maintenance in the long run.
- How long does it take to charge an EV? Charging times vary from 30 minutes (fast chargers) to several hours (home chargers).
- Are EV batteries recyclable? Yes, EV batteries are recyclable, and efforts are underway to improve recycling methods.
- Do EVs perform well in cold weather? Modern EVs are designed to handle cold climates, though range may decrease slightly.
- What’s the lifespan of an EV battery? Most EV batteries last 8-10 years or about 100,000 to 200,000 miles.
- Can EVs tow heavy loads? Certain models, like the Rivian R1T, are designed for towing and heavy-duty tasks.
- Are there enough charging stations? Infrastructure is expanding rapidly, with more public chargers added each year.
- Do EVs require special insurance? EV insurance is similar to gas cars but may vary slightly based on the vehicle’s value.
- Can I charge an EV with solar panels? Yes, you can install solar panels at home to power your EV sustainably.
- What happens if an EV runs out of charge? Similar to running out of gas, you’d need a tow to the nearest charging station.
